Ticket VLT-2241 — For the release manager: the Pixelproof snapshot-testing vault for our UI component baselines locked itself after the Fernbrook CI runner retried authentication five times. Golden snapshots for the Button and Modal suites cannot be compared until the vault is reopened, which blocks the 4.2 release sign-off. Per the escrow procedure, the recovery passphrase appears below.

unlock words, kajef-kadug: sorys-pelax-lamael-tamvan-briiel-novdor-fenwyn-tamdor-oliion-keleth-julok-belion-ralok

FINANCE REVIEW SUMMARY — Support Outsourcing (Project Larkwell)
For: Heads of Department

Outsourcing tier-1 support to Brindlecote Services cuts annual cost 31%. Transition spend recovered within five quarters. Quality risk rated moderate; SLA penalties negotiated. In-house team reduced to escalation-only by Q3. Approval expected at next steering meeting. The confidential business-plan note appears directly below.

internal memo for yahaf-hawif: The finance team signed off on a budget of $59.9 million for Project Rusax.

Capacity note for the Bramblewick export retry queue. Failed exports are requeued with exponential backoff, and the queue depth is our main capacity signal: sustained depth above the high-water mark means downstream Pellis storage is saturated, not that we need more workers. As the new contractor, please don't raise worker counts without checking storage latency first — it usually makes things worse. Retry timing, backoff caps, and the high-water threshold are all driven by the constants shown below.

limits module of yagef-bajog:
TIERS = {
    "druael": 370,
    "tamix": 286,
    "pelius": 541,
    "pelael": 78,
    "pelox": 47,
    "ralath": 533,
    "drumir": 801,
}